Woody tastes and smells

If your water tastes or smells woody, like pencil wood, this can be caused by older pipework, commonly used in the 1960s and 1970s which have alkathene in them.  This is not harmful.  Flushing your taps for a few minutes before you use the water will improve the taste.  In order to completely resolve the issue you will need to replace your pipework, contact an approved plumber (watersafe.org.uk) for further advice.
